Antalya: The Pearl of the Turkish Riviera! 🇹🇷✨

Antalya is a stunning coastal city that perfectly blends history, nature, and modern luxury. From its breathtaking beaches and crystal-clear waters to its ancient ruins and vibrant nightlife, there’s something for everyone! 🌊🏝️ 🏛️ Historical Wonders: Explore the ancient cities of Perge, Aspendos, and Termessos, or wander through the charming streets of Kaleiçi, Antalya’s Old Town. 🌅 Natural Beauty: Visit the stunning Düden and Kurşunlu Waterfalls or take a boat trip along the picturesque coastline. 🏖️ Beach Paradise: Relax on the famous Konyaaltı and Lara beaches or discover hidden gems like Kaputaş Beach.
